The Integration of Cryptocurrency and Blockchain Technology
Modern platforms frequently leverage the benefits of cryptocurrency and blockchain technology. Using cryptocurrency can provide faster and more secure transactions, eliminating some of the traditional barriers associated with online gaming, such as geographical restrictions and high transaction fees. Blockchain technology, with its inherent transparency and immutability, can be used to ensure fairness and provably random outcomes in games which relies on the verifiable randomness. This builds trust between the platform and its users, addressing concerns about manipulation or bias. The decentralized nature of blockchain can also offer greater security and resilience against attacks compared to centralized systems.
Furthermore, blockchain opens up possibilities for innovative reward systems, such as non-fungible tokens (NFTs) that represent in-game assets or achievements. These NFTs can be traded on dedicated marketplaces, creating new economic opportunities for players. The combination of skill-based gameplay, cryptocurrency, and blockchain technology has the potential to revolutionize the gaming industry, offering a more engaging, transparent, and rewarding experience for players.

Navigating Risk and Responsible Gaming
It's essential to acknowledge that any form of online gaming, particularly those involving financial incentives, carries inherent risks. The volatility of cryptocurrency markets adds another layer of complexity, and the potential for losses should be carefully considered. Responsible gaming practices – such as setting limits on spending and time spent playing – are paramount. Before engaging with any platform, it's crucial to thoroughly research its reputation, security measures, and terms of service. Understanding the rules of the game and the associated risks is vital for making informed decisions.
Furthermore, it’s important to avoid chasing losses and to treat gaming as a form of entertainment, not a guaranteed source of income. The temptation to recoup losses can lead to impulsive decisions and potentially significant financial setbacks. A disciplined approach and a clear understanding of the risks involved are key to enjoying a positive and sustainable gaming experience. Remember, no matter how skilled you are, there is always an element of chance involved.
